1832 Asset Management L.P. Lowers Stake in Interactive Brokers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:IBKR)

1832 Asset Management L.P. cut its position in Interactive Brokers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:IBKRFree Report) by 9.6%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 609,981 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 65,021 shares during the period. 1832 Asset Management L.P. owned approximately 0.14% of Interactive Brokers Group worth $68,141,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Interactive Brokers Group (NASDAQ:IBKRG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 16th. The financial services provider reported $1.76 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.74 by $0.02. Interactive Brokers Group had a return on equity of 4.88% and a net margin of 7.88%. The company had revenue of $1.29 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.27 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$1.32 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 21.2%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Interactive Brokers Group, Inc. will post 6.76 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Interactive Brokers Group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, September 13th. Investors of record on Friday, August 30th will be issued a $0.25 dividend. This represents a $1.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.84%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, August 30th. Interactive Brokers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 17.09%.

About Interactive Brokers Group

(Free Report)

Interactive Brokers Group, Inc operates as an automated electronic broker worldwide. The company engages in the execution, clearance, and settlement of trades in stocks, options, futures, foreign exchange instruments, bonds, mutual funds, exchange traded funds (ETFs), precious metals, and cryptocurrencies.
